1st Death Note Film to Play in Canadian Theaters (Anime News Network)
Viz Pictures, an affiliate of Viz Media , has announced that the first live-action film based on Tsugumi Ohba and Takeshi Obata ’s Death Note manga will run in about 60 Cineplex Entertainment and Empire Theatres locations in Canada on September 15. There will be one showing on that Monday at each location at 9:00 p.m. local time.

Faith-based group asks Tories to block porn channel (Vancouver Sun)
OTTAWA — A faith-based conservative family group said it would like the Harper government to intervene to block a broadcasting licence issued to a new Canadian porn channel. The Canada Family Action Coalition wants cabinet to overturn last week’s decision by the Canadian Radio-television and Telecommunications Commission to grant a licence to adult film network Northern Peaks.
